Highlights
Are people in Bloomfield older or younger than people in Crete?
- The Median Age in Bloomfield is 9.0 years older than in Crete.
Are housing costs cheaper in Bloomfield or Crete?
- Bloomfield
housing
costs are 14.4% less expensive than Crete hous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Bloomfield or Crete?
- The average commute for residents of Bloomfield is 0.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Crete.
Things to do in Crete?
Crete, NE is a vibrant and lively small city. Located in the heart of Nebraska, it is known for its charming downtown area full of restaurants, shops, and entertainment venues. Residents enjoy a laid-back atmosphere that encourages outdoor activities like biking and hiking along the winding paths within town. Education here is top notch with excellent public schools for all ages as well as private schools and universities nearby. The abundance of parks around the city make it easy to get outside and explore nature too. All in all, Crete is a great place to call home, offering a safe and welcoming community for everyone!
Things to do in Bloomfield?
Living in Bloomfield, IA is a great experience that offers a unique blend of modern convenience and traditional charm. The small town atmosphere allows for easy access to all the amenities one needs while still being surrounded by natural beauty. Residents can enjoy the outdoors with an abundance of parks, trails, and nearby waterways. There are also plenty of opportunities for shopping, dining, entertainment and cultural activities. With its friendly people, safe streets, and excellent school system, Bloomfield is considered one of the best places to live in Iowa.
